Should the city of Galveston be relocating homeless people and transporting them off the island?

In response to increased complaints, island officials are surveying the city’s homeless population, perhaps with an eye toward taking those who want to leave back to where they came from, officials said.
City council members have received numerous complaints from constituents about an increase in the homeless population and have set up a task force with members of several nonprofit organizations, Mayor Craig Brown said.
The city has anecdotal information the population is increasing because homeless people are being transported to the island initially either to the Galveston County Jail or University of Texas Medical Branch facilities, Brown said.
Heath Harkins, a homeless man living in Galveston, said fear about being shipped off the island is spreading among the homeless. He called The Daily News last week to say police had been detaining and taking homeless people off the island and were following him.
